MEAT & POTATO CASSEROLE

This hearty Meat & Potato Casserole is the perfect comfort food! Layers of seasoned ground beef, tender potatoes, and melted cheese create a rich, satisfying dish that's easy to make and family-approved.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 45 minutes
Total Time 1 hour
Course Dinner
Cuisine American
Servings 6 people
Calories 420 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• 1 lb ground beef
  • 1 small onion diced
  • 2 cloves garlic minced
  • 4 cups potatoes peeled and thinly sliced
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• ½ te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
  • 1 can 10.5 oz cream of mushroom soup
  • ½ cup milk
  • 1 ½ cups shredded cheddar cheese
  • ½ teaspoon smoked paprika optional
  • 2 tablespoons butter melted

Instructions
 

  • Step 1: Preheat & Prep –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C) and grease a 9x13-inch baking dish.
  • Step 2: Cook the Beef – In a skillet, cook ground beef with onion and garlic until browned. Drain excess grease. Season with salt, pepper, and Italian seasoning.
  • Step 3: Layer the Casserole – Spread half of the sliced potatoes in the baking dish, then top with half of the beef mixture. Repeat layers.
  • Step 4: Mix & Pour Sauce – In a bowl, mix cream of mushroom soup and milk. Pour over the casserole, ensuring even coverage.
  • Step 5: Bake & Add Cheese – Cover with foil and bake for 40 minutes. Remove foil, sprinkle cheese and smoked paprika on top, and bake uncovered for 5 more minutes until melted.
  • Step 6: Serve & Enjoy – Let cool for a few minutes before serving. Drizzle with melted butter for extra richness.

Notes

  • Make Ahead: Assemble the casserole a day in advance and refrigerate before baking.
  • Customizing the Flavor: Add bell peppers or mushrooms for extra veggies.
  • Serving Suggestions: Serve with a side salad or steamed green beans.
  • Allergy-Friendly Options: Use dairy-free cheese and soup for a lactose-free version.
  • Storage Tips: Refrigerate leftovers in an airtight container for up to 3 days.
